Ezequiel 21:23

Simplificado — Traducción al Español Moderno

Traducido por Verse Made Simple Editorial
KJV ORIGINAL
And it shall be unto them as a false divination in their sight, to them that have sworn oaths: but he will call to remembrance the iniquity, that they may be taken.
Cercano al original. Español claro y moderno.
✦ SIMPLIFICADO

Para ellos, parecerá como una profecía falsa, especialmente para aquellos que hicieron promesas pensando que los protegerían. Pero Dios recuerda cada cosa mala que han hecho, y así es exactamente como serán atrapados.

⚡ EN RESUMEN

Aunque los malvados crean que las advertencias de Dios son falsas, Él recuerda sus pecados y los juzgará por ellos.

📚 Contexto Histórico

During the Babylonian exile in the 6th century BC, the prophet Ezekiel was warning the people of Judah about God's judgment for their ongoing rebellion and broken covenants. They had made oaths and alliances, such as with Egypt, which they mistakenly saw as reliable protections, but these were exposed as futile in the face of divine justice. God used Ezekiel to remind them that their accumulated sins would lead to their defeat and capture by the Babylonians.
